Plastic Compounding Machinery Market Analysis

The Plastic Compounding Machinery Market is expected to register a CAGR of 6% during the forecast period.

  • Plastics compounding refers to the process of taking basic, raw plastic material and customizing it with various additives to achieve various properties, colors, and performance requirements. Various physical processes and lab formulations achieve this by combing the necessary additives and color into the plastic resin.
  • Various types of machinery are used to achieve the entire process of preparing the formulation plastic by blending and mixing polymers and additives. The rising use of plastic components across various end-user industries drives the demand for plastics. For instance, according to the University of Georgia, the cumulative production of plastic is anticipated to reach 34 billion metric tons by 2050, from a mere 2 billion metric tons in the 1950s.
  • Furthermore, the increasing demand for high-strength, low-weight, fuel-efficient, and durable components in the automotive sector, allowing them to comply with environmental and related norms, is expected to boost the adoption of plastic compounding machinery in the industry. Similarly, the food and beverage industry is expected to exhibit growth in the adoption of plastic compounding machinery, owing to the increasing adoption of plastic in the industry, to enable lightweight end-products with a focus on product design.
  • Also, plastic compounding machinery is finding its applications in the bioplastics industry. The adoption of bioplastics in various end-user industries is increasing. According to European Bioplastics, the global production of bioplastics is expected to grow from 1,792 thousand metric tons in 2021 to 6,291 thousand metric tons by 2027.
  • However, low capacity utilization in the manufacturing Industry owing to slow offtake and the high cost of this equipment are among the major factor challenging the studied market's growth.
  • A notable impact of COVID-19 has been observed on the studied market. Asia Pacific region, which is among the major user of plastic compounding machinery owing to the presence of several major players, a higher impact of the pandemic resulted in a slowdown in demand. However, with major end-user industries on their way to recovery, the studied market is expected to witness an upward growth trend during the forecast period.

  • November 2022 - Brabender launched the new electrically heated twin-screw extruder B-TSE-S 30/40 Big Compounder. According to the company, the extruder was developed as an interface between the pilot plant and the laboratory. Its compact design combines the drive and processing unit, making it suitable for developing formulations and small-scale production of various extrudates made of plastics, food and feed, rubber, and many other extrudable materials.
  • July 2022 - Bausano, an Italy-based extrusion machinery manufacturer, introduced its Smart Energy System for cylinder induction heating at K 2022. The product has been designed for both a twin screw extruder Nextmover range and the new single screw extruder E-GO R, which is designed for recycling plastics. According to the company, the product features forced-cooled induction coils with special openings to minimize heat loss. Furthermore, for faster cooling compared to resistive systems, the cooling airflow is channeled directly onto the plasticizing cylinder.

Plastic Compounding Machinery Market News

  • March 2022 - Bausano, a leading designer and producer of customized extrusion lines for transforming plastic materials, launched its next-generation single and twin-screw extrusion lines for pipes made of PVC and polyolefins (PO). The company's extrusion technology in its twin-screw MD and single-screw E-GO ranges enables the production of different types of pipes - rigid or flexible, smooth or corrugated, mono or multilayer, for various applications, including construction, medical, and agriculture.
  • February 2022 - Star Plastics, a leading plastic compounder, installed a new twin-screw extruder at its Ravenswood, WV, facility. According to the company, the 75-mm Leistritz twin-screw extruder is its largest extruder, tripling capacity in anticipation of continued long-term growth. The company is also planning to add a second twin-screw extruder soon.

Compounding is a process of blending plastics with various other additives by melting and mixing. The compounding process changes the plastic's physical, thermal, electrical, or aesthetic characteristics. The processing of engineering plastics and masterbatch plastics puts high demands on the compounding process.
